Tuesday night’s Britney/Brittany episode of Glee has been the most hyped episode of the season, and it definitely didn’t disappoint. John Stamos (who is henceforth known as Dr. Feelgood) was introduced into the series, Brittany’s last name was revealed and Miss Spears herself actually donned a Cheerios uniform.
Britney Spears watched the episode, along with millions of Gleeks, offering Twitter updates throughout. “Heather Morris is so cute!” She Tweeted at one point. “Brittany S. Pearce. Ha! She was so fun to work with and was really sweet in person,” Brit revealed.
“The Me Against the Music set looks just like the original. Santana [Naya Rivera] does a great Madonna impression,” Britney said a little later, when Santana and Brittany both underwent dental treatments, as provided by Dr. Carl (Stamos), to hallucinate the Britney Spears video.

Glee Cast Taking the Show on the Road
Posted by Veronica Santiago Categories: Comedy, Music, Prime Time, FOX, News,
The White House won’t be the only location welcoming the Glee cast this year. Later this spring, members of the FOX series will be following in the footsteps of their American Idol and So You Think You Can Dance predecessors. That’s right—they’ll be going on tour.
Residents near Phoenix (May 18), Los Angeles (May 20-21), Chicago (May 25- 26) and New York (May 28-29) will get to see the entertainers perform a number of fan favorites including “Don’t Stop Believin,” “Somebody To Love,” “Jump,” “Don’t Rain on My Parade” and “Sweet Caroline.”
Those scheduled to make the road trip are Lea Michele, Cory Monteith, Amber Riley, Chris Colfer, Kevin McHale, Jenna Ushkowitz, Mark Salling, Dianna Agron, Naya Rivera, Heather Morris, Harry Shum, Jr. and Dijon Talton.
